Trauma Informed Care is an approach to engaging people with histories of trauma that recognizes the presence of trauma symptoms and acknowledges the role that trauma has played in their lives. Trauma Informed Care also acknowledges the effects of working with trauma survivors on our workforce, and seeks to build collaborative and supportive working environments and relationships.

The mission of Heartland Family Service is to strengthen individuals, families, and communities through advocacy, education, counseling, and support services.
We serve more than 120,000 people annually from locations in the Omaha metro and southwest Iowa.
